FCE Bank plc is a dual-regulated bank and a proud part of Ford Motor Company - a globally recognised brand leading its transformation towards electric and connected vehicles.
FCE plays a vital role in this journey, providing innovative financing solutions that enable customers to access Ford vehicles, while supporting dealers and the wider automotive ecosystem. Through Ford Money, we also offer secure and accessible savings products in the UK and Germany.
Joining FCE means being part of a global, forward-looking organisation focused on delivering exceptional customer experiences, building long-term relationships, and driving innovation as we evolve our business for the future.
